Learn MoreDiamond grinding is a pavement preservation technique that corrects a variety of surface imperfections on both concrete and asphalt concrete pavements. Most often utilized on concrete pavement, diamond grinding is typically performed in conjunction with other concrete pavement preservation (CPP) techniques such as road slab stabilization, full- and partial-depth repair, dowel bar retrofit

Learn MoreBall Mill Ball mills with high efficiency separators have been used for raw material and cement grinding in cement plants all these years. Ball mill is a cylinder rotating at about 70-80% of critical speed on two trunnions in white metal bearings or slide shoe bearings for large capacity mills.

Learn MoreTurbo rim blades are also a solid option for cutting concrete. These blades feature a series of holes cut into their metal body near the unit's center. These act as heat sinks that draw out heat while the blade is in motion. This can ensure that the blade remains plenty cool, even while cutting through limestone and similar materials.

Learn MoreConcrete grinding wheels, as well as other abrasive tools, comprise two major components - the abrasive grains that do the cutting and the bond that holds the grains in place while they cut. The percentages of grain and bond plus spacing in the wheel determine its structure.
